Output 7b96565c32705e2dcb6ffae6cd36eafcc07c7bbfbb0364fd083fbc3aa107a611:1

value
1324984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8303271e568305ebd3d60fe33358e204bcadb6e8 OP_EQUAL
address
3DdkDjYjJLvSvf7Fuz5eSBssEE1Gu3aar1
transaction
7b96565c32705e2dcb6ffae6cd36eafcc07c7bbfbb0364fd083fbc3aa107a611
confirmations
399093
spent
true